Conferences and EventsConferences and EventsCHME 9-12 June 2026DescriptionThe Discipline of Surrey Hospitality and Tourism Management in Surrey Business School is delighted to be hosting CHME 2026, which will take place at the University of Surrey on 9 -12 June 2026. The Council for Hospitality Management Education (CHME) is an influential organisation which lobbies government bodies and external organisations to strengthen and develop hospitality management education. CHME’s stated purpose is to contribute to the professional development and status of the UK and International Hospitality Management education, through the sharing of best practices in scholarship and pedagogy. https://www.surrey.ac.uk/events/20260609-chme-2026-annual-conference
UTSG 2026 (13-15 July 2026)DescriptionThe Discipline of Surrey Hospitality and Tourism Management in Surrey Business School is delighted to be hosting the 58th UTSG Conference 2026, which will take place at the University of Surrey on 13 -15 July 2026. The Universities’ Transport Study Group (UTSG), initiated by the late Professor R.J. Smeed of University College London in 1967, aims to promote transport teaching and research and to act as a focus for those involved in these activities in universities and institutions of higher education in the UK and Ireland. UTSG has over 50 University members, with over 100 Departments contributing to its activities. UTSG membership is free for institutions which meet its requirements and all positions on its elected Executive Committee are honorary. In addition to the membership from the UK and Ireland, over 70 academic institutions are represented on its list of overseas correspondents. https://utsg.net/annual-conference_2026
